string UbbToHtml(string input)
{
string ret;
ret = input.Replace("\r\n", "<br/>"); //換行
ret = ret.Replace(" ", " ");//空格
//轉換顏色
ret = System.Text.RegularExpressions.Regex.Replace(ret, @"\[COLOR=([^]]+)\]([^[]+)\[/COLOR\]", "<span style=\"color:$1;\">$2</span>", System.Text.RegularExpressions.RegexOptions.IgnoreCase);
//粗
ret = System.Text.RegularExpressions.Regex.Replace(ret, @"\[B\]([^[]+)\[/B\]", "<b>$1</b>", System.Text.RegularExpressions.RegexOptions.IgnoreCase);
//斜
ret = System.Text.RegularExpressions.Regex.Replace(ret, @"\[I\]([^[]+)\[/I\]", "<i>$1</i>", System.Text.RegularExpressions.RegexOptions.IgnoreCase);
//下劃線
ret = System.Text.RegularExpressions.Regex.Replace(ret, @"\[U\]([^[]+)\[/U\]", "<u>$1</u>", System.Text.RegularExpressions.RegexOptions.IgnoreCase);
//居中
ret = System.Text.RegularExpressions.Regex.Replace(ret, @"\[CENTER\]([^[]+)\[/CENTER\]", "<div align=\"center\">$1</div>", System.Text.RegularExpressions.RegexOptions.Ignore